Spreadsheet exports in Ledgerbird are the top memory offender during quarter-end, so we cap them hard rather than letting one tenant OOM a worker. Exports above the row cap get split into multiple files automatically; anything beyond the cell cap is rejected with a retryable error. If you're paged for export OOMs, check these first. The enforced limits are as follows.

tuning table, yajog-yahof:
BUDGETS = {
    "lamvan": 303,
    "wenox": 460,
    "fenvan": 525,
}

### Health checks

Quick note for support: the Brindlemark nodes behind the Tollgate load balancer answer on `/healthz`, and the LB marks a node dead after three misses. If you're poking the deep-check endpoint (`/healthz/full`), it hits the internal Pulseboard service and needs auth, so don't panic at a 401. Use the key below when curling it manually.

app token of tagef-tafog = qvz3-7n0

### Account Recovery — Catalogue Import (Lintwood)

Quick one for review: when the Lintwood catalogue import wipes a patron's session table, the recovery flow re-seeds accounts from the nightly snapshot. Check that the importer skips locked accounts — last time it didn't. To rerun recovery against staging you'll need the vault passphrase, which is appended just below.

recovery phrase for yafof-tajof: julmir-kelax-julvan-holath-belvan-holir-ralael-ralvan-ralath-julvan-silmir-istmir-kaswyn-ulamir